1. A method for identifying a modulator of catalase ubiquitination, the method comprising:
a) contacting a polypeptide to ubiquitin in the presence of a test compound, wherein the polypeptide comprises catalase or a fragment thereof that binds to ubiquitin;
b) measuring the ubiquitination of the polypeptide in the presence of the test compound,
wherein altered ubiquitination of the polypeptide in the presence of the test compound compared to the absence of the test compound indicates that the compound is a modulator of catalase ubiquitination.
